Add 20/70 and 6/12
20/70 + 6/12 is 11/14.
Steps for adding fractions
-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
LCM of 70 and 12 is 420
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 420 - For the 1st fraction, since 70 × 6 = 420,
20/70 = 20 × 6/70 × 6 = 120/420 -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 12 × 35 = 420,
6/12 = 6 × 35/12 × 35 = 210/420 - Add the two like fractions:
120/420 + 210/420 = 120 + 210/420 = 330/420 - 330/420 simplified gives 11/14
- So, 20/70 + 6/12 = 11/14
